Efficient parity placement schemes for tolerating up to two disk failures in disk arrays

被引:13
|
作者
Lee, NK
Yang, SB
Lee, KW
机构
[1] Yonsei Univ, Dept Comp Sci, Secodaemum Ku, Seoul 120749, South Korea
[2] LG Elect Inc, Seoul, South Korea
关键词
disk arrays; DH schemes; parity placement methods; fault tolerence; two disk failures;
D O I
10.1016/S1383-7621(00)00031-X
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In order to achieve high reliability in disk array systems, two new schemes using dual parity placement, called DH1 (diagonal-horizontal) and DH2 schemes, are presented. Both DH schemes can tolerate up to two disk failures by using two types of parity information placed in the diagonal and the horizontal directions, respectively, in a matrix of disk partitions. DH1 scheme can reduce the occurrences of the bottleneck problem significantly because the parity blocks are evenly distributed throughout the disk array. DH2 scheme uses one more disk than DH1 scheme in order to store the horizontal parities, while the diagonal parities are placed in the same way as in DH1 scheme with a minor change. Even though both DH schemes use almost optimal disk space for storing the redundant information, the encoding algorithms for them are quite simple and efficient. Moreover, both DH schemes can recover rapidly from any two disk failures. (C) 2000 Elsevier Science B.V. All rights reserved.
引用
收藏
页码:1383 / 1402
页数:20
相关论文
共 50 条
  • [1] Efficient parity placement schemes for tolerating triple disk failures in RAID architectures
    Tau, CS
    Wang, TI
    AINA 2003: 17TH INTERNATIONAL CONFERENCE ON ADVANCED INFORMATION NETWORKING AND APPLICATIONS, 2003, : 132 - 137
  • [2] Striping in a disk array with data/parity placement scheme RM2 tolerating double disk failures
    Park, CI
    I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 1996, E79D (08) : 1072 - 1085
  • [3] EFFICIENT PLACEMENT OF PARITY AND DATA TO TOLERATE 2 DISK FAILURES IN DISK ARRAY SYSTEMS
    PARK, CI
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1995, 6 (11) : 1177 - 1184
  • [4] Balanced RM2: An improved data placement scheme for tolerating double disk failures in disk arrays
    Kim, DW
    Lee, SH
    Park, CI
    COMPUTATIONAL SCIENCE - ICCS 2004, PT 3, PROCEEDINGS, 2004, 3038 : 371 - 378
  • [5] Tolerating Triple Disk Failures in Triple-Parity RAID
    Jing, Minghaw
    Lee, Chong-Dao
    Chang, Yaotsu
    Su, Kai
    IEEE INTERNATIONAL SYMPOSIUM ON NEXT-GENERATION ELECTRONICS 2013 (ISNE 2013), 2013,
  • [6] Study of graph decompositions and placement of parity and data to tolerate two failures in disk arrays: Conditions and existence
    Zhou, Jie
    Wang, Gang
    Liu, Xiao-Guang
    Liu, Jing
    Jisuanji Xuebao/Chinese Journal of Computers, 2003, 26 (10): : 1379 - 1386
  • [7] A practical parity scheme for tolerating triple disk failures in RAID architectures
    Park, CW
    Han, YY
    ADVANCES IN COMPUTING SCIENCE-ASIAN 2000, PROCEEDINGS, 2000, 1961 : 58 - 68
  • [8] PERFORMANCE CONSEQUENCES OF PARITY PLACEMENT IN DISK ARRAYS
    LEE, EK
    KATZ, RH
    SIGPLAN NOTICES, 1991, 26 (04): : 190 - 199
  • [9] Modified low-density MDS array codes for tolerating double disk failures in disk arrays
    Fujita, Hachiro
    Sakaniwa, Kohichi
    IEEE TRANSACTIONS ON COMPUTERS, 2007, 56 (04) : 563 - 566
  • [10] Modified low-density MDS array codes for tolerating double disk failures in disk arrays
    Superrobust Computation Project, The University of Tokyo, 5-1-5 Kashihanoha, Kashiwa, Chiba 277-8561, Japan
    不详
    IEEE Trans Comput, 2007, 4 (563-566):